Professional Background
Bruce Berdanier is a distinguished academic and engineer with a profound dedication to the fields of environmental engineering and hydrogeology. With an extensive career spanning multiple decades, Bruce currently serves as the Dean and Professor at the Jerome J. Lohr College of Engineering at South Dakota State University. His leadership at South Dakota State University has been instrumental in shaping the direction of engineering education and research, focusing on innovative approaches to environmental challenges.
Before taking on this pivotal role, Bruce's academic career was marked by key positions at various prestigious institutions. He was previously the Dean of Engineering at Fairfield University, where he significantly contributed to the development and enhancement of engineering curricula and research initiatives. Additionally, he held the position of Professor and Head at South Dakota State University, further solidifying his reputation as a leader in academic engineering.
Bruce's teaching journey began as an Assistant Professor of Civil and Environmental Engineering at South Dakota School of Mines and Technology. It was here that he laid the groundwork for his educational philosophy and research interests, fostering a deep understanding of civil and environmental challenges facing society today.
Moreover, Bruce's experience extends beyond academia. He was an Owner Engineer and Surveyor at Village Engineering Ltd, a role that allowed him to apply his technical skills in practical settings, contributing to various projects with a focus on environmental sustainability and community development.
Education and Achievements
Bruce earned his PhD in Environmental Engineering and Hydrogeology from The Ohio State University, a prestigious institution known for its strong emphasis on research and innovation. His doctoral studies provided him with a solid foundation in understanding the complexities of environmental systems and the critical need for sustainable engineering solutions.
